executive summary

The Stockholm market presents a nuanced landscape for American-inspired cuisine, characterized by robust competition in the burger, BBQ, and specialty sausage segments. Established players like Barrels, Brickyard, Burgers'n'Fuel, and Brisket & Friends command strong ratings (4.3-4.7) and significant review volumes, indicating a healthy, sustained demand for quality American comfort food. These establishments have successfully cultivated loyal customer bases by focusing on specific niches within the American culinary spectrum, from gourmet burgers to authentic smoked meats. However, a critical analysis of the existing ecosystem reveals a distinct and significant void in the "24/7 Cheap American Diner" niche. Current competitors operate primarily within standard restaurant hours, typically closing by late evening, and mostly at a mid-tier price point (level 2). Günters stands out as the notable exception at price level 1, specializing in hot dogs and experiencing significant queues due to its compelling value proposition, underscoring the market's responsiveness to affordability.

Stockholm's dynamic urban demographic, comprising a diverse mix of students, young professionals, international residents, tourists, and a vibrant nightlife, generates consistent, round-the-clock demand for convenient, accessible, and value-driven dining options. The current market is demonstrably underserved by establishments offering a broad American comfort food menu—encompassing all-day breakfast items, classic burgers, milkshakes, and traditional pies—combined with genuine 24/7 availability and an aggressively competitive price point. Late-night food options are predominantly limited to generic fast-food chains, convenience stores, or prohibitively expensive hotel restaurants, leaving a substantial gap for a sit-down, affordable, and character-filled alternative.

The proposed "24/7 Cheap American Diner" is strategically positioned to capitalize on this unmet demand by becoming the definitive destination for late-night cravings, early morning sustenance, and budget-conscious diners seeking authentic American fare. Success hinges on several critical factors: firstly, meticulous operational efficiency and streamlined processes are essential to support continuous 24/7 service without incurring prohibitive costs; secondly, stringent cost management across the supply chain is paramount to maintain competitive pricing while ensuring a sustainable business model; and thirdly, a relentless focus on delivering consistent quality and a memorable experience, despite the "cheap" moniker, is vital to build trust and repeat patronage. While the broader market for American-style food is indeed saturated, the *specific intersection* of 24/7 operation, genuine affordability, and a comprehensive, classic diner menu represents a blue ocean opportunity within Stockholm's otherwise competitive culinary scene. The primary challenge will involve navigating the high labor costs associated with 24/7 operations in Sweden while steadfastly upholding the "cheap" promise without compromising food safety, hygiene, or fundamental quality expectations. Strategic location within high-traffic, entertainment-heavy corridors, coupled with robust marketing emphasizing value and accessibility, will be paramount for market penetration and sustained growth.
